The wine
A Marc de Bourgogne from Gabiel Boudier, a house founded in 1874 in Dijon originally under the name Fontbonne. The house was bought in 1909 by Gabriel Boudier, who changed the company name to his own, then by Marcel Battault in 1936. His descendants continue to run the business today. The house is best known for its crème de cassis and liqueurs.
